Abstract

The Future Is Dead. Long Live the Future!

Mad artist Amy Alexander presents a few of her recent inventions for creating live audiovisuals and real-time cinema in non “movie” contexts. Interwoven with her own work will be some historical examples of audiovisual and other arty inventions, with an eye toward considering the role of the mad artist in inventing the future.
